Job Description
Join EM Characteristics as a Full-Time TIG Welder in Scarborough. You will use your welding skills on a range of metals in a bustling production environment.

This day shift position requires a minimum of three years' experience in TIG welding, with the ability to work both independently and within a team. You must skillfully weld aluminum, stainless steel, and steel while prioritizing quality and safety. Your role will play a crucial part in maintaining efficiency and a clean workspace in our manufacturing facility.

Key Responsibilities:
• Perform TIG welding on aluminum, stainless steel, and steel
• Exhibit strong attention to detail and quality of work
• Work collaboratively and independently with little oversight
• Uphold a safe and organized workspace
• Participate in ongoing process improvement initiatives

Requirements:
• 3 years of TIG welding experience required
• Aluminum welding capability mandatory
• Based in Greater Toronto Area
• Excellent hand-eye coordination essential
• Canadian Citizens or valid Work Authorization holders only

Bring your TIG welding expertise to EM Characteristics and thrive in Scarborough's dynamic manufacturing sector.

Q What is the median hourly wage for welders in Canada in 2026?
The median hourly wage for welders (NOC 72106) in Canada is $31.25 as of January 2026, with low wages at $22.00 per hour and high wages at $40.50 per hour. Full-time annual earnings average $65,000 based on 40 hours per week. These figures reflect national data across all provinces.
Q What work permit do international welders need to work in Canada?
International welders require an employer-specific work permit supported by a positive Labour Market Impact Assessment (LMIA) costing $1,000, or qualify via Global Talent Stream with 10-day processing. Fees include $155 for the work permit application and $85 biometrics. Welders (TEER 2) may use Express Entry Federal Skilled Trades with 2 years full-time experience.
Q What education and experience qualify me for welder jobs in Canada?
A high school diploma or equivalent is required to start a welder apprenticeship, which totals 6,720 hours including 6,000 on-the-job and 720 classroom hours over 4 years. At least 1-2 years experience is needed for journeyperson status via provincial exam. Red Seal certification confirms national standards.
Q What documents do I need to apply for welder jobs in Canada?
Submit a resume listing welding tickets, CWB certifications, apprenticeship hours, and safety training like WHMIS 2015 and confined space entry. Include proof of Red Seal or provincial journeyperson certificate and 3 references. For immigrants, add work permit and language test results like IELTS CLB 5.
